Abstract

The invention relates to a non-contact type organic body surface and sound wave comprehensive feature analysis controller, which comprises a plurality of modules. The controller can control general electric devices having a switch and a working interface and can temporarily and quickly build a half-permanent wireless synchronous working network. The controller has a safety insulation structure which can provide insulation measures when in danger. Compared with the traditional products, the safety of user is ensured.

Description

Organic feature recognition controller
Affiliated technical field:
The present invention relates to the control device of a kind of General Electric equipment, belong to an innovative technology of biological characteristic analysis, microelectronics control and the combination of electrical engineering field, be used for the Comprehensive Control of electrical structure equipment.
Background technology:
At present; domestic electrical control gear manufacturer all seldom produces the electrical control gear with non-human body essence manner of execution (for example stroke switch motion, human body contact action etc.); so generally under special circumstances; old man for example; children; physical disabilities wait the use crowd; or high temperature, forceful electric power leak; the necessary Body contact of user; could control electric utility, as electric light, electrical equipment or the like city electric installation; and under situations such as fire or electrical equipment overload, existing product can't provide complete insulation protection for human body.The present invention adopts biological acoustic characteristic identification software engine advanced in the world; in conjunction with the body surface induction technology; by the open frequency range of 2.4G Hz global radio; and nanometer technology controller and electrical equipment; civil power business level electric utility has been realized that non-human body contact controls fully; and adopting high hard silicon dioxide element is main pyroceram and insulator, and the possibility that contacts of isolated fully human body and circuit has greatly improved the degree of protection to human body.The present invention has filled up the market vacancy, for the numerous consumer groups provide the more selection of diversification.
Summary of the invention:
Technical scheme of the present invention is:
1, adopts the difference algorithm of hyperchannel vocal print sampling, biological sound wave is sampled, analyze, relatively;
2, by the programming to microcontroller, the sound wave sampled result is screened, filtering through calculating, outputs to control port with the result;
3, by peripheral buffer circuit, the microcontroller output signal is isolated amplification, control peripheral electrical equipment, civil power equipment is controlled;
4, by quarantine measures, user and strong power system are kept apart fully, stop the possibility that human body contacts with strong power system;
5, adopt the non-direct contact type mode that the target output action is controlled;
6, in the open frequency range in the 2.4GHz whole world, use the data sharing function to transmit the operating state of each module, extremely low radiation does not have time-delay, and Fast Installation need not be changed original circuit, realizes contactless networking control fully.
Beneficial effect of the present invention:
The edge scientific research task of effectively contactless biometric being controlled this bioelectronics combination realizes and produced according to relative theory can be for the popular equipment that uses; Simultaneously, in product structure design, by contactless isolation design to human body and forceful electric power loop, improved security and the comfortableness manipulated greatly, in case be in an emergency, as burn, short circuit etc., device will be ruined the forceful electric power device, and the electric current that human body is constituted a threat to can't touch human body, improve the safety guarantee coefficient that uses colony.
Description of drawings:
As figure, accompanying drawing is system frame structure figure.The present invention is further described below in conjunction with accompanying drawing.
As shown in the figure, among the figure, 1 represents user's acoustic wave source acquisition module, and the 2nd, the sample waveform datumization relatively reaches analysis module, and the 3rd, micro controller module, the 4th, wireless data input/output module, the 5th, contactless control module, the 6th, electric current isolated loop module.
